Job Title Network Specialist Job Description Location: Pune, India Experience Required: 10+ Years Job Summary: We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Senior Network Engineer to join our global IT Operations Center (ITOC). The ideal candidate will be responsible for designing, implementing, monitoring, troubleshooting, and optimizing enterprise network infrastructure across global data centers and business locations. This role requires strong expertise in routing, switching, firewalls, VPN technologies, wireless networking, network security, and operational support within a 24x7 environment. The successful candidate will play a critical role in ensuring network availability, performance, security, and continuous improvement through automation and proactive infrastructure management. Key Responsibilities Network Operations & Support Monitor and maintain the health, performance, and availability of global network infrastructure and data center environments. Provide advanced L2 and L3 support for network incidents, service requests, and problem management activities. Troubleshoot complex network connectivity, performance, and security issues across LAN, WAN, WLAN, and VPN environments. Take ownership of critical incidents and ensure timely resolution within defined SLAs. Collaborate with global IT teams, business units, and external vendors for issue resolution and service improvements. Network Administration & Engineering Configure, deploy, and support: Layer 2 & Layer 3 Switches Enterprise Routers Cisco ASA / Firepower Firewalls Wireless LAN Controllers and Access Points VPN Gateways and Remote Access Solutions Load Balancers and QoS Implementations Design, implement, and support secure site-to-site and remote-access VPN solutions. Perform network infrastructure upgrades, firmware updates, security patching, and lifecycle management activities. Execute approved changes following established change management and configuration management processes. Network Monitoring & Performance Management Utilize enterprise monitoring and diagnostic tools such as: Nagios Wireshark PRTG SNMP-based monitoring solutions Proactively identify performance bottlenecks and implement corrective actions. Analyze network traffic patterns and capacity requirements to improve infrastructure efficiency and reliability. Develop and maintain network documentation, topology diagrams, asset inventories, and operational procedures. Network Security & Compliance Implement and maintain network security controls, firewall rules, VPN configurations, and access policies. Monitor network security events and collaborate with cybersecurity teams to mitigate risks. Ensure compliance with corporate security standards, best practices, and regulatory requirements. Participate in vulnerability remediation and security improvement initiatives. Automation & Continuous Improvement Drive automation initiatives to improve operational efficiency and reduce manual effort. Develop scripts and automated workflows for network monitoring, reporting, configuration backup, and routine maintenance tasks. Identify opportunities for process optimization and service enhancements. Contribute to network architecture reviews and infrastructure modernization projects. Required Qualifications Education Bachelor’s degree in engineering,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field. Certifications CCNA and CCNP Certification (Mandatory) Additional certifications such as Cisco Security, Fortinet, Palo Alto, or ITIL are highly preferred. Technical Skills Strong understanding of TCP/IP, DNS, DHCP, VLANs, STP, OSPF, BGP, NAT, ACLs, QoS, and VPN technologies. Deep understanding of OSI and TCP/IP networking models. Hands-on experience with Cisco routing and switching technologies. Expertise in Cisco ASA/Firepower firewall administration and troubleshooting. Experience supporting WAN, SD-WAN, MPLS, VPN, and wireless network environments. Proficiency with network monitoring, packet analysis, and troubleshooting tools. Knowledge of network security frameworks and best practices. Experience in automation and scripting using PowerShell, Python, or similar technologies is preferred. Required Competencies Strong analytical and problem-solving skills. Excellent verbal and written communication skills. Ability to work effectively in a global, multicultural team environment. Strong customer service orientation and stakeholder management capabilities. Excellent time management, prioritization, and incident management skills. Ability to perform under pressure in a 24x7 operational environment. Strong documentation and support case management skills. Preferred Experience Experience supporting enterprise-scale global networks and data centers. Experience working in a Network Operations Center (NOC) or IT Operations Center environment. Familiarity with cloud networking concepts (Azure, AWS, or Google Cloud). Exposure to network automation and infrastructure-as-code methodologies. Experience with ITIL service management processes.
